Signs a Laurel Roof May Be Near the End of Service Life

Common warning signs include widespread granule loss, curling or cracking materials, recurring water entry, soft or damaged decking, failing flashings, repeated blow-offs, and repairs that no longer match the existing roof. These conditions are considered together rather than relying on one symptom alone. Materials, Ventilation, Flashing and Drainage

A new roof performs as a system. Material selection is coordinated with underlayment, ventilation, flashings, penetrations, edges, valleys, roof-to-wall transitions, and gutters so one upgraded component does not leave an old failure point unaddressed.

What Happens After the Scope Is Approved?

After approval, materials and scheduling are coordinated around the property and weather window. The crew prepares the site, removes or prepares the existing roof as specified, reviews exposed conditions, installs the new system, completes cleanup, and walks through open items with the owner.
